A laptop is sold for $800 after a discount of 20%. What was the marked price?
Step 1: Understand that the selling price of the laptop is $800 after a discount of 20%.
Step 2: Let the marked price be represented as 'x'.
Step 3: Calculate the selling price after the discount. The selling price is 80% of the marked price because a 20% discount means you pay 80%.
Step 4: Write the equation for the selling price: Selling Price = Marked Price - Discount = x - 0.2x = 0.8x.
Step 5: Set up the equation: 0.8x = 800.
Step 6: Solve for 'x' by dividing both sides of the equation by 0.8: x = 800 / 0.8.
Step 7: Calculate the value: x = 1000.
Step 8: Conclude that the marked price of the laptop is $1000.
